6G Wireless Technology: Unleashing a New Era of Connectivity and Innovation

The world is on the cusp of a technological revolution with the emergence of 6G wireless technology. Building upon the achievements of its predecessors, 6G aims to deliver even faster speeds, lower latency, and greater capacity. With its potential to enable a wide range of new applications and services, the impact of this next-generation wireless technology is expected to be profound.

Speed and Performance

Projected to reach terabits per second, 6G will usher in an era of near-instantaneous downloads and uploads. Tasks that are currently data-intensive will become seamless and effortless. Picture downloading an entire high-definition movie in a matter of seconds or uploading large files instantaneously. With 6G, the possibilities for fast and efficient connectivity are boundless.

Increased Capacity

One of the most significant advancements of 6G is its increased capacity, which allows for a massive number of devices to be connected simultaneously. This innovation paves the way for the Internet of Things (IoT) to flourish, with billions of interconnected devices seamlessly communicating with each other. From smart homes and intelligent transportation systems to connected healthcare devices, every aspect of our lives will be enhanced by this seamless connectivity.

Timeline for Commercial Availability

While the world eagerly awaits the arrival of 6G, commercial availability is estimated to be around 2030. However, research and development efforts are already in full swing in various countries. Governments, academia, and industry players are collaborating to unlock the true potential of 6G, ensuring that it meets the evolving needs and expectations of users worldwide.

Research and Development Efforts

The quest for 6G wireless technology is already underway across the globe. Countries like China, the United States, South Korea, and Finland are leading the way with their research and development efforts. These nations recognize the immense potential of 6G to drive economic growth and technological advancements. Interdisciplinary teams of researchers and industry experts are working tirelessly to explore the possibilities of 6G and lay the groundwork for its future implementation.
